Резюме

Обобщены данные из литературных источников и полученные нами результаты полевых исследований по распространению, стациальной приуроченности, численности и размножению полевок рода Blanfordimys Argyropulo, 1933: афганской полевки B. afghanus (Thomas, 1912) с подвидами B. a. afghanus и B. a. balchanensis (Heptner et Shukurov, 1950), бухарской полевки B. bucharensis (Vinogradov, 1930), с подвидами B. b. bucharensis и B. b. davydovi (Golenishchev et Sablina, 1991) и памирской полевки B. juldaschi (Severtzov, 1879) с подвидами B. j. carruthersi (Thomas, 1909) и B. j. juldaschi,  в природных условиях на территории Туркмении, Таджикистана и Киргизии. По градиенту высотности от низко- до высокогорья эти полевки распределяются следующим образом: афганская, бухарская и памирская, соответственно. Исследованы особенности размножения и постэмбрионального онтогенеза в условиях неволи. Размножение происходило круглогодично с низкой интенсивностью; число новорожденных в помете у всех рассмотренных видов невелико – в среднем 3 детеныша, средний интервал между пометами – около 50 дней. Несколько быстрее развиваются детеныши полевок, обитающих на меньших высотах (B. afghanus и B. bucharensis) по сравнению с более высокогорными (B. juldaschi). В целом для изученных видов отмечено медленное развитие, запаздывание появления в постэмбриональном онтогенезе наиболее важных признаков (прорезывание резцов, прозревание) по сравнению с большинством равнинных представителей полевок трибы Arvicolini. Эти особенности сильнее выражены у полевок B. j. juldaschi, обитающих на бо́льших высотах. Таким образом, в ключе теории синдрома темпа жизни (pace-of life syndrome, POLS) мы наблюдаем сдвиг от более быстрого темпа жизни (r-стратегии), характерного для большинства равнинных грызунов, к более медленному (k-стратегии). Отмечена уязвимость полевок рода Blanfordimys в процессе аридизации климата и в условиях антропогенного пресса.
